Den nya versionen av LXC och LXD 4.0 har redan släppts och det är dess nyheter

Canonical har släppt släppet av den nya versionen av dina verktyg för att organisera driften av isolerade containrar LXC 4.0, containerchefen LXD 4.0 och FS LXCFS virtual 4.0 för simulering i behållare / proc, / sys och virtualiserade cgroupfs för distributioner utan stöd för cgroup-namnområden.

För dem som inte känner till dessa verktyg, borde de veta det LXC är en körtid för att köra både systemcontainrar och containrar för enskilda applikationer (OCI). LXC inkluderar liblxc-biblioteket, en uppsättning verktyg, mallar för att skapa behållare och en uppsättning mappar för olika programmeringsspråk.

LXD är ett plugin-program för LXC, CRIU och QEMU vad som används för att centralt hantera containrar och virtuella maskiner på en eller flera servrar. Om LXC är en verktygslåda på låg nivå för att manipulera på nivån för enskilda behållare, implementeras LXD som en bakgrundsprocess som accepterar förfrågningar via nätverket via REST API och låter dig skapa skalbara konfigurationer implementerade i ett kluster av flera servrar.

Stöder olika lagringsbackends (katalogträd, ZFS, Btrfs, LVM), ögonblicksbilder med en statlig avstängning, levande migrering av arbetsbehållare från en maskin till en annan och verktyg för att organisera bildlagring. LXD-koden är skriven i Go och distribueras under Apache 2.0-licensen.

Vad är nytt i LXC 4.0?

I den här nya versionen, styrenheten för att arbeta med cgroup har skrivits om helt, Förutom det lagt till stöd för enhetlig cgrouphierarki (cgroup2), tillagd fryskontrollfunktionalitet med vilken du kan sluta arbeta med cgroup och tillfälligt frigöra vissa resurser (CPU, I / O och eventuellt till och med minne) för att utföra andra uppgifter.

också lagt till stöd för kärnsystem "pidfd" utformad för att hantera PID-återanvändningssituation (pidfd går med i en specifik process och ändras inte, medan PID kan kopplas till en annan process efter att ha slutfört den nuvarande processen som är associerad med denna PID)

Dessutom, en infrastruktur implementerades för att fånga upp systemanrop och skapandet och borttagningen förbättrades för nätverksenheter, liksom deras rörelse mellan namnområdena för nätverksdelsystemet.

Och möjligheten att flytta trådlösa nätverksenheter (nl80211) till containrar implementerades.

Vad är nytt i LXD 4.0?

För att segmentera LXD-servrarna, ett projektkoncept har föreslagits som förenklar hanteringen av containergrupper och virtuella maskiner. Varje projekt kan innehålla sin egen uppsättning containrar, virtuella maskiner, bilder, profiler och lagringspartitioner. I förhållande till projekt kan du ställa in dina egna begränsningar och ändra inställningar.

De stöd för att lansera inte bara containrar utan också virtuella maskiner, också stöd för avlyssning av systemanrop för behållare, samt stöd för shiftfs, en virtuell FS för tilldelning av monteringspunkter till användarnamnsområdet (användarnamnsområde).

Lagt till möjligheten att konfigurera MAC-adressen och bestämma källadressen för NAT och även ett tillagt API för att hantera bindningar i DHCP.

Dessutom tillhandahålls i den här nya versionen automatiserad skapande av ögonblicksbilder av miljöer och lagringsavsnitt med möjlighet att ställa in en ögonblicksbilds livslängd.

Av de andra nämnda förändringarna i annonsen:

  • Implementerad säkerhetskopiering och återställning av miljön.
  • Lagt till API för att övervaka nätverksstatus (lxc nätverksinformation).
  • Nya typer av "ipvlan" och "dirigerade" nätverksadaptrar föreslås.
  • Tillagd backend för att använda CephFS-baserade lagringar.
  • Kluster stöder bildreplikering och konfigurationer med flera arkitekturer.
  • Lade till rollbaserad åtkomstkontroll (RBAC).
  • Lagt till stöd för CGroup2.
  • Stöd för Nftables lades till.

Slutligen om du vill veta mer om det om nyheterna om den här nya versionen kan du kontrollera detaljerna I följande länk.


Lämna din kommentar

Din e-postadress kommer inte att publiceras. Obligatoriska fält är markerade med *

*

*

  1. Ansvarig för uppgifterna: Miguel Ángel Gatón
  2. Syftet med uppgifterna: Kontrollera skräppost, kommentarhantering.
  3. Legitimering: Ditt samtycke
  4. Kommunikation av uppgifterna: Uppgifterna kommer inte att kommuniceras till tredje part förutom enligt laglig skyldighet.
  5. Datalagring: databas värd för Occentus Networks (EU)
  6. Rättigheter: När som helst kan du begränsa, återställa och radera din information.